Job Requirements

  • Must be able to stand for an entire shift and lift up to 50 pounds occasionally
  • Frequent bending, reaching, walking, and use of hands
  • Varying kitchen environments with moderate noise levels
  • Full-time schedule, Monday through Friday, with occasional extended weeks
  • Must be able to drive between school sites and attend company meetings as needed

Job Qualifications

  • Previous food service or cleaning experience preferred
  • Reliable transportation and ability to travel to different locations daily
  • Strong work ethic, flexibility, and ability to adapt to changing needs
  • Comfortable working in fast-paced and varying environments
  • Basic math and computer skills
  • Must pass a background check and fingerprint screening and MVR
  • Enjoys working around children and being part of a school community
  • Respectful, inclusive, and able to work with diverse teams

Job Duties

  • Travel between school sites as scheduled to assist with daily kitchen operations
  • Prepare and serve food according to recipes, production records, and safety standards
  • Keep workspaces clean, organized, and safe
  • Restock serving areas such as food lines, salad bars, and milk boxes
  • Assist with receiving and organizing deliveries using FIFO practices
  • Serve meals to students, staff, and guests with a positive attitude
  • Perform routine cleaning tasks like sweeping, mopping, and trash removal
  • Follow all health and safety regulations at each site
  • Step in to support kitchen teams or cover absences
  • Submit reports and complete assigned tasks on time
  • Take direction from Kitchen Managers and adjust quickly to new team dynamics
